  • Page 14 NI-Sync. For more information visit ni.com/pxi NI-VISA is the National Instruments implementation of the VISA specification. VISA is a uniform API for communicating and controlling USB, Serial, GPIB, PXI, VXI, and various other types of instruments. This API aids in the creation of portable applications and instrument drivers.

    PXI Features PXI Trigger Connectivity The SMB connector on the NI PXI-8106 front panel can connect to or from any PXI backplane trigger line. A trigger allocation process is needed to prevent two resources from connecting to the same trigger line, resulting in the trigger being double-driven and possibly damaging the hardware.

    OS. When doing so, consider the following guidelines. Installing from a CD-ROM The NI PXI-8106 supports the installation of Windows XP from a USB CD-ROM. However, many other operating systems do not support installation from a USB CD-ROM. For example, Windows 2000 aborts during the install process because it does not have drivers for the CD-ROM device.

    How do I connect a standard 25-pin LPT cable to the NI PXI-8106? The NI PXI-8106 uses a type C LPT connector. Most parallel port devices use a type A connector. To use a device with a standard type A LPT connector, you need to use a type C-to-type-A LPT adapter.

    Chapter 4 Common Configuration Questions My NI PXI-8106 does not have an internal floppy drive. Is there a way to use an external drive? Yes. The NI PXI-8106 controller supports and can boot from USB floppy drives. A USB floppy drive will not work with Windows NT4, but will work with Windows 2000 or Windows XP.
